Peak Amps vs. Cranking Amps: What Matters Most
Understanding the difference between peak amps and cold cranking amps (CCA) is critical for selecting the right jump starter. Peak amps represent the absolute maximum current a unit can supply for a fraction of a second, which is a common marketing metric. In reality, the engine needs cranking amps—the sustained flow of current required to turn the engine over for several seconds.
Always look for a unit that specifies cranking amps or offers a higher amp rating to ensure it can handle the initial resistance of a cold engine. Diesel engines, in particular, have higher compression ratios and require significantly more power to overcome the friction of thickened cold oil. Relying solely on the “peak” number often leads to disappointment in the field.
A unit with a higher amp rating is generally safer for the vehicle’s electronics, as the starter will not have to struggle as long to engage. Always err on the side of having more capacity than necessary. A jump starter that is barely strong enough to turn the engine over will eventually lead to unnecessary wear on the vehicle’s starter motor and ignition system.
Safely Jump Starting a Heavy-Duty Farm Truck
Safety is the absolute priority when dealing with the high energy stored in jump starters and vehicle batteries. Always connect the positive (red) clamp to the positive terminal first, then attach the negative (black) clamp to a solid, unpainted metal ground point on the engine block rather than the negative battery terminal. This minimizes the risk of sparks occurring near potential hydrogen gas emitted by the battery.
If the engine fails to start within five seconds, stop and wait for a full minute before trying again. This allows the jump starter’s internal chemistry to stabilize and prevents overheating the cables or the starter. Forcing the unit to engage for extended periods can cause permanent damage to the lithium cells or internal circuitry.
Inspect the clamps and cables for any signs of damage or fraying before each use. A compromised cable can lead to significant voltage drops, rendering the best jump starter ineffective. When in doubt, ensure the connection is tight and the surfaces are clean of heavy corrosion.
Keeping Your Jump Starter Ready in a Cold Barn
Lithium jump starters lose their efficacy rapidly if stored in freezing temperatures. Even if the unit is advertised as cold-weather capable, storing it in a warm location inside the house or a heated gear room will significantly extend its lifespan and performance. The goal is to bring a fully charged, room-temperature unit out to the cold vehicle when the need arises.
Implement a strict charging schedule, such as checking the status of the unit every two months. Many modern jump starters have a self-discharge rate that can drain the unit over a long, dormant winter season. A dead jump starter is just as useless as a dead truck battery.
Keep the unit in a designated, dry spot where moisture cannot penetrate the internal electronics. Condensation is the enemy of any electronic device, especially in a farm environment where humidity levels fluctuate. A simple waterproof storage container or a dedicated bag will protect the unit from the dust and moisture common in a barn.
Can You Jump a Tractor with These Starters?
Yes, most of these jump starters are capable of starting tractors, but size matters significantly. A small garden tractor might only require 200-300 amps, while a larger utility tractor with a diesel engine could require over 1000 amps. Always check the CCA rating on the tractor’s battery label and ensure the jump starter matches or exceeds that requirement.
Consider the tractor’s battery voltage as well, as many larger tractors use 24-volt systems instead of the standard 12-volt system found in most trucks. Connecting a 12-volt jump starter to a 24-volt system can cause severe damage to the unit and potentially the tractor’s electrical system. Always verify the voltage before making any connections.
Tractors often have battery terminals that are difficult to access, making cable reach an important consideration. Ensure the chosen jump starter has long enough cables to make a secure, safe connection. If the tractor is stored in a remote part of the property, the portability of a lithium-based unit is a distinct advantage.
